gpt4 book ai didi

video - FFMPEG -filter_complex 未生成所需的输出

转载 作者:行者123 更新时间:2023-12-04 22:59:48 26 4
gpt4 key购买 nike

我在尝试着
在视频底部嵌入字幕和
在视频的右上角添加图像/文本水印和
在顶部和底部添加文本
在同一命令中在视频的顶部和底部添加彩色填充

以下是我可以得到一些工作的命令。这是在底部而不是顶部添加填充。它虽然成功地在视频中嵌入了字幕。
它也干扰了视频的某些部分,将它们推到顶部并裁剪视频的顶部(因为我认为底部有填充),但视频的某些部分就位并且没问题。

我试图在 FFMPEG 中编写命令并使用复杂的过滤器,但我不确定如何正确使用它们。有人可以指导如何解决这个问题并正确使用过滤器复杂,因为文档太复杂了

命令

ffmpeg -y -i video-orignal.mp4 -i watermark.jpg -filter_complex "[0:v]pad=iw:ih+300:0:0:purple[padded]; [padded]overlay=main_w-overlay_w-5:5[watermarked]; [0:v][watermarked]overlay=W-w-10:H-h-10,subtitles=subtitles-final.ass[out]" -map "[out]" -map 0:a video-final.mp4

最佳答案

填充和水印覆盖更正。在顶部和底部添加文本。

ffmpeg -y -i video-orignal.mp4 -i watermark.jpg
-filter_complex "[0:v]pad=iw:ih+300:0:150:purple[padded];
[padded][1]overlay=main_w-overlay_w-5:155,
subtitles=subtitles-final.ass,
drawtext=fontfile='/path/to/font':fontsize=50:fontcolor=white:text='Top Text':
x=main_w/2:y=160,
drawtext=fontfile='/path/to/font':fontsize=50:fontcolor=white:text='Bottom Text':
x=main_w/2:y=main_h-th-160[out]"
-map "[out]" -map 0:a video-final.mp4

关于video - FFMPEG -filter_complex 未生成所需的输出,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/46904115/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com